Ep 11 Somatic Practices for Work Productivity with Whitney Dawn Pyles
<p>Are you feeling stuck at your desk or overwhelmed by a mounting to-do list? </p><p>Whitney Dawn Pyles joins The Ripple Effect Podcast to offer a refreshing perspective on professional growth through somatic coaching. </p><p>This episode is packed with "micro-practices" that take less than three minutes but can completely reset your nervous system for a more productive, joyful workday.</p><p><strong>Three Micro-Practices for Your Workday:</strong></p><ol><li><p><strong>Body Scanning:</strong> Building awareness of where your body is in space to invite immediate presence.</p></li><li><p><strong>Orientation:</strong> A simple sensory exercise to look away from the screen and remind your nervous system that you are safe.</p></li><li><p><strong>Intuitive Movement:</strong> Savoring a stretch or trying "shaking" to wake up your system and release kinetic energy.</p></li></ol><p>Please reach out to Whitney Dawn!</p><p><a href="https://www.whitneydawn.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ferer">Her website</a></p><p><a href="https://www.linkedin.com/in/whitneydawnpyles/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ferer">Her LinkedIn</a></p>

Ep 10 - Empathy In The Workplace with Leanne Butterworth
<p>Empathy isn’t about “being nice”—it’s a proven driver of innovation, retention, and revenue.</p><p>In this episode of the Ripple Effect podcast, host Meghan speaks with Leanne Butterworth, the most recognized empathy leader in Australia. </p><p>Leanne is an empathy educator, TEDx speaker, author, university lecturer and social entrepreneur on a mission to create happy, healthy workforces andcommunities by delivering empathy content that is interactive, accessible and fun!</p><p>This conversation explores Leanne's journey to becoming an empathy expert, the three types of empathy, and practical steps to enhance empathy in the workplace. </p><p><br></p><p>Links:</p><p><a href="http://www.empathyfirst.com.au/"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">www.empathyfirst.com.au</a></p><p><a href="http://www.linkedin.com/in/leannebutterworth"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">www.linkedin.com/in/leannebutterworth</a></p><p><a href="http://www.instagram.com/empathyfirsthq"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">www.instagram.com/empathyfirsthq</a></p><p>Watch her TEDx Talk - here - <a href="http://www.empathyfirst.com.au/tedxqut"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">www.empathyfirst.com.au/tedxqut</a></p><p><br></p><p>The leadership coach who connected Leanne and I, <a href="https://www.linkedin.com/in/renee-shea/"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">Renee Shea</a></p>

Ep 9 Boundaries As A Leadership Tool with Helen Young McLaughlin
<p>In this episode of the Ripple Effect podcast, Helen Young McLaughlin shares her journey as a leader and coach, emphasizing the importance of empathy, effective communication, and setting boundaries in the workplace. She discusses how these elements contribute to a healthier organizational culture and better team engagement.
